To disable Java auto-update option

For Windows XP
1) Start -> Control Panel -> double click on the Java icon



2) Click on the Update tab, and then uncheck Check for Updates Automatically. If there is no
Update tab in the Java control panel, it means the auto-update feature is off (It could be turned
off during installation or due to some other reasons). If this is the case, you do not need to do
anything.

3) The following message will pop up. Click on Never Check. And then click Apply and OK.





4) If you reopen the Java Control Panel (refer step 1), under update tab you should see the Check
for Updates Automatically is unchecked.


5) Done
For Windows 7
1) Open Windows Explorer and navigate to C:\Program Files (x86)\Java\jre6\bin.










2) Right click on the file javacpl.exe and click on Run as Administrator.

3) Click on the Update tab, and then uncheck Check for Updates Automatically. If there is no
Update tab in the Java control panel, it means the auto-update feature is off (It could be turned
off during installation or due to some other reasons). If this is the case, you do not need to do
anything.


4) The following message will pop up. Click on Never Check. And then click Apply and OK.





5) If you reopen the Java Control Panel (refer step 1), under update tab you should see the Check
for Updates Automatically is unchecked.


6) Done
